Sorry bud, but Plato specifically referred to Atlantis being beyond the Straits of Gibraltar. It ain't referred to as being in the Mediterranean. Other people who make up stuff beyond what Plato made up doesn't provide additional evidence.

And no, "there was likely some Egypt in there" doesn't bolster your point. Plato said that Socrates was speaking with an Egyptian priest about Atlantis. That's the reference point.

Atlantis isn't real. Neither is Darth Vader, Harry Potter, the Matrix, that teleporting Black Fortress from Krull, flux-capacitors or even Dr. Gregory House. The jury is out on oscillation overthrusters.


Not only is the geography wrong (beyond the Pillars of Hercules) but so is the date (Plato's ca 9600 BCE vs. Minoan late 2700 - 1400s BCE) AND couple that with the fact that the only mention (in its narrative) is Plato and we've got little to no history.

Sorry, Atlantis is a myth. But hey, its supporters will mold, change, alter, mash and shove anything they can into Plato's account. That's great storytelling, but it doesn't pass as history.
